Boston College will be holding their open practice today, but at a new time due to the snow. If you are interested in attending the event, it will be held at 11am. The open practice format was chosen by the school for undisclosed reasons, Steve Addazio saying that it would help maximize practice time for the team.
What most likely will be a lightly attended event, however will have multiple recruits in attendance. On twitter over the past few days recruits from the high school class of 2016 and 2017 have tweeted that they will be attending the event. Some of the high school kids that could be in attendance include but are not limited to:
Jordan Scott, 2017 athlete from Rahway High School, Rahway New Jersey
Linwood Crump, 2016 athlete from Sayreville, NJ
Ronnie Blackmon, 2016 cornerback from Georgia, Boston College commit
Evan Powell, 2016 QB from Cherokee High School, Marlton New Jersey
Michael Dwumfour, 2016 DE from DePaul Catholic High School, Wayne New Jersey
DeJohn Rogers, 2016 Athlete from Matawan High School, Matawan New Jersey
